unable to see api keys tab in app store connect portal

I want to use app store connect api to automate our build workflow. I followed https://developer.apple.com/documentation/appstoreconnectapi/creating_api_keys_for_app_store_connect_api.But i coundn't find api keys tab in Users and Access section.

For anyone who cannot see the key tab, you must be an account holder to generate the key. Perhaps there were a new policy from Apple that requreied only Account Holder to generate API key.

Mine did not have key in the menu. But it did have Integration. When I click on there i was able to create a key

as @markatlarge said, is now under Integration tab and then generate the App Store Connect API

The docs are not up to date. You can find it under integrations tab. Hope this helps :)
